INTENSIVES IN CONSCIOUS LEADERSHIP

Held over a two-year period, these intensives address the deeper levels of the Leader-Self and provide an overview of an integral approach to modern day leadership and organizational challenges. Our approach to Leadership training moves beyond traditional leadership methods that focus on changing individual surfacebehaviors and organizational structures, and explores root causes along with the impact of the surrounding social systems and organizational culture. These intensives can be taken independently or applied to the Conscious Leadership Institute Certificate Program.

The second of four Leadership Intensives addresses these aspirations. We will work with the inner strengths of the leader at the causal level in order to better engage others in meaningful conversation and to build more productive work relationships. We will see how our biology and our inner state influence each other and explore how they both directly impact our (1) level of reactivity, (2) the quality of our behavior, (3) the tone of our conversation, and (4) our ability to achieve results.  We will learn to manage our energy and understand its impact on the quality of our listening and our ability to speak clearly and directly. We will develop our ability to let go of judgments and preconceived ideas while maintaining discerning wisdom and will:

  • Deepen our capacity for awareness and presence
  • Listen with curiosity, spaciousness and compassion
  • Speak clearly from the heart as we choose our words carefully
  • Learn the skills of inquiry and skillful advocacy
  • Surface assumptions and un-discussable issues and identify unproductive behaviors
  • Manage anxiety in the face of ambiguity and change.
  • Convert anger to strength and use that energy to act with clarity
  • Use skillful conversation to motivate effective action

Being an effective leader is difficult.  Today, this is especially true in today’s environment. Leaders are asked to rise above their personal reactions and short term interests.  Today’s leader must develop the capacity to 1) hold multiple perspectives, 2) discern the best from these perspectives and 3) act for the highest good of the whole. We must push to the limits of our current identity and develop a more expansive inner foundation from which to act.  Some of the capacities that answer this need include:

  • Handle competing demands effectively
  • Manage internal and external stress with ease
  • Become more resilient and recover quickly from setbacks
  • Moving beyond either/or positions
  • Reframing difficult situations 
  • Integrate multiple intelligences
  • Create a safe space and build trust
  • Develop a culture that nurtures innovation and continuous learning

Ron KertznerLynnea Brinkerhoff has significant experience in designing and implementing personal and organizational effectiveness interventions. Her professional experiences range from revitalizing aging multinational organizations to structuring new small businesses. Lynnea is skilled at long-term executive coaching, mediating conflicts between individuals and departments, and designing a complete team-based environment. Lynnea coaches and guides using the natural flow and opportunities available within the client's organizational structure and culture. Lynnea also has led strategic planning and performance management programs and conducted executive searches.Lynnea received her Masters in Organization Development from Pepperdine University's MSOD program and a B.A. in International Business from Simmons College.

Lynne FeldmanLynne Feldman, M.A., J.D. - Lynne received her BA from Tulane, her MA in Public Law and Government from Columbia, and her law degree from Pace Law School.  In 2003 Ken Wilber asked Lynne to be VICE-CHANCELLOR of INTEGRAL UNIVERSITY. In 2003 she created the Center for Integral Education which has presented at international Integral education seminars.  She has also taught at Maezumi Institute, and the New York Open Center. Lynne is an Integral Scholar; a contributor to and on the Review Board of the Journal of Integral Theory and Practice and is writing a book on Integral education.  She has been published in Kosmos Journal, the Journal of Integral Theory and Practice, and the New York Times.  Her web site can be found at www.LynneDFeldman.org.  

Ron KertznerRev. Ron Kertzner, JD blends his background in organizational development with his interfaith ministry to help individuals and organizations make conscious choices to produce truly meaningful results. He co-founded, with his wife, Susan, ChoicePoint Consulting, Inc., a management consulting firm that focuses on leadership development/personal mastery; coaching and conversations and facilitating collaborative change. He is the contributing author of Rediscovering the Soul of Business and Four Gateways Coaching. Organizations he has worked with include General Electric, Intuit, Motorola, Aera Energy, and Ceridian. He has also served as facilitator and consultant to numerous international and national conferences including The United Nations Democratic Dialogue Project, the Parliament of the World's Religions and the United States Congress. Based in Boulder, Colorado, Ron hosts teleclasses on topics such as personal mastery, exploring the shadow and masterful coaching. Along with his wife, Susan, Ron thoroughly loves spending time with his daughter, Elisa, 11, who is from Guatemala, and their two dogs, Cookie and Gracie! He holds an B.A. in public policy from Duke University, a J.D. from Boston University and graduated from OneSpirit Interfaith Seminary in 2005. He is currently a student of Sri Prem Baba, a master of the Sachcha lineage from the Himalayas as well as a shamanic leader in an Amazonian tradition.

PergolaRev. Michael Pergola, MA, MBA, JD co-Founder & President of One Spirit Learning Alliance, served as Chief Knowledge Officer at a large bank for six years and practiced law for nine years. He is a teacher, facilitator, mediator, biofeedback practitioner and executive coach who teaches and consults Fortune 500 companies in the areas of leadership, communication, organizational learning and creativity.
